Essential Ingredients
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ious dish:
-
Boneless, Skinless Chicken Breasts: About 3-4 chicken breasts work well; adjust depending on your guest list.
-
Fresh Garlic: A must-have for that aromatic punch; choose firm cloves for maximum flavor.
-
Sun-Dried Tomatoes: These provide a sweet and tangy burst; oil-packed ones are ideal for extra richness.
-
Fresh Spinach: Use baby spinach for its tender texture; it wilts beautifully in the sauce.
-
Cream Cheese: This gives the sauce its signature creaminess; full-fat yields the best results. cream cheese tortilla bites.
-
Parmesan Cheese: Freshly grated is best; it adds a nutty depth to your sauce.
-
Chicken Broth: Use low-sodium broth to control salt levels while adding flavor.
-
Olive Oil: Extra virgin works wonders here; it enhances everything with its fruity notes.
-
Italian Seasoning: A blend of herbs like basil and oregano elevates the dish’s flavor profile.
-
Salt and Pepper: Essential for seasoning throughout; adjust based on your taste preferences.

Let’s Make It Together
Prep Your Ingredients: Start by gathering all your ingredients. Dice the garlic finely and chop your sun-dried tomatoes into bite-sized pieces. This ensures everything cooks evenly.
Sear the Chicken: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Season chicken breasts with salt and pepper, then sear them until golden brown on both sides—about 6-8 minutes each side should do.
Add Aromatics and Veggies: Toss in minced garlic and sun-dried tomatoes into the pan once the chicken is cooked through. Sauté until fragrant—this will take about 1-2 minutes.
Create That Creamy Sauce!: Lower the heat before adding cream cheese, chicken broth, and Italian seasoning into the pan. Stir continuously until everything melds together into a luscious sauce—this should take about 3-4 minutes.
Add Spinach and Cheese: Stir in fresh spinach and grated Parmesan cheese until wilted—this will happen quickly! The cheese will add depth while bringing everything together beautifully.
Serve It Up!: Plate your creamy Tuscan chicken over pasta or rice for an elegant touch. Garnish with additional Parmesan if desired, then enjoy each luscious bite!

Storing & Reheating
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. Reheat gently on the stove over low heat, adding a splash of cream to retain its luscious texture.

FAQ
Can I use boneless thighs instead of chicken breasts?
Yes, boneless thighs add more flavor and tenderness to this recipe.
What sides pair well with creamy Tuscan chicken?
Serve it with garlic bread and a fresh garden salad for balance.
How can I make this dish dairy-free?
Substitute cream with coconut milk and cheese with nutritional yeast for a dairy-free version.
Creamy Tuscan ‘Marry Me’ Chicken
- Total Time: 35 minutes
- Yield: Serves 4
Description
Creamy Tuscan ‘Marry Me’ Chicken is a dreamy dish that transforms tender chicken into a savory sensation. Bathed in a rich sauce of sun-dried tomatoes, fresh spinach, and garlic, this recipe is perfect for cozy weeknights or special occasions. It’s quick to prepare and guarantees smiles all around, making it an ideal choice for family dinners or romantic evenings.
Ingredients
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 4 cloves fresh garlic, minced
- 1 cup sun-dried tomatoes, chopped
- 3 cups fresh baby spinach
- 8 oz cream cheese
- 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 cup low-sodium chicken broth
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 2 tsp Italian seasoning
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Gather and prep ingredients: mince garlic and chop sun-dried tomatoes.
-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Season chicken with salt and pepper, then sear until golden brown (6-8 minutes per side).
- Add garlic and sun-dried tomatoes to the pan; sauté for 1-2 minutes until fragrant.
- Lower heat, then mix in cream cheese, chicken broth, and Italian seasoning. Stir until combined (3-4 minutes).
- Add spinach and Parmesan cheese; stir until spinach wilts and cheese melts.
- Serve over pasta or rice, garnished with additional Parmesan if desired.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 20 minutes
- Category: Main
- Method: Skillet
- Cuisine: Italian
